Jim Weber, the Toledo Mud Hens' play-by-play announcer for 49 years, has died at age 78, the team announced Friday. Weber first began calling Mud Hens games on the radio in April 1975, staring ...
— Toledo Mud Hens (@MudHens) August 2, 2024. Weber got his start with the Triple-A team, a longtime Detroit Tigers affiliate, on April 12, 1975.
